This volume comprises the speeches of William L. Yancey, a senator from the state of Alabama, delivered in the Senate of the Confederate States during the session commencing on August 18, 1862. These addresses offer a valuable insight into the political and ideological landscape of the Confederacy during a crucial period of the American Civil War. Yancey, a prominent figure in the secessionist movement, presents his arguments and perspectives on the pressing issues facing the Confederate nation. This collection serves as a primary source for understanding the motivations and strategies of Confederate leaders and the challenges they confronted in their attempt to establish an independent nation. "Speeches of William L. Yancey, Esq., Senator From the State of Alabama" is an essential resource for historians and scholars interested in the political history of the Civil War.
